Comparison of 5-FU versus FUDR activity in human colorectal cancer using an in vitro clonogenic assay (HTCA).

Abstract:

:Comparative in vitro drug testing was performed in 72 of 183 surgically removed human colorectal cancer specimens (34 primary lesions, 38 metastases). In 10 of these tumors, comparative dose-response curves were obtained. Given a greater than or equal to 70% ICF (inhibition of colony formation) as threshold for in vitro sensitivity, 5-FU was active in 16/62 specimens, and FUDR in 14/62. Significantly discordant sensitivity results were observed in 8/62 tests, 5-FU being the more active agent in 5 of these cases. These data are supported by the finding of 3 considerably differing dose-response curves in 10 additional comparative studies of human primary tumors.
